During the time when northerners helped black slaves from the South to escape from the southern plantations through the underground railroad, most of the black people tried to escape from states such as Alabama, Mississippi, Louisiana to Illinois and Ohio. Black people from Virginia tried to escape to Buffalo and Vermont. Many times, slaves tried to cross the border to Canada, to be free.
